Best Hotels in Singapore 2026

Singapore is expensive for accommodation by Asian standards but offers world-class quality. The MRT makes location less critical — almost everywhere is 30 minutes from everything. Marina Bay, Orchard Road, and Chinatown are the most popular areas.

Before You Book

Singapore hotels are consistently high quality — even budget hotels tend to be clean and well-managed

Booking.com flash deals can cut prices significantly — check 1–2 weeks ahead

MRT proximity is less critical than in Bangkok — Singapore's network is so fast and comprehensive

Serviced apartments in Tanjong Pagar or Tiong Bahru offer good value for 5+ night stays

Budget Hotel Tips

Chinatown and Little India have the best budget hotel value — clean rooms from S$60–90/night

Capsule hotels like Capsule Pod and POD have brought Tokyo-style capsule sleeping to Singapore at S$40–60/night

Hostels in Kampong Glam and Geylang area offer beds from S$25–40/night

Consider Jurong East or Woodlands for cheaper options if you don't mind commuting — MRT is fast

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the best area to stay in Singapore?

Marina Bay for the iconic views and luxury experience. Chinatown/Tanjong Pagar for the best budget value in a convenient location. Orchard Road for shopping-focused stays. All areas are connected by fast MRT.

Is Singapore expensive for hotels?

Singapore is expensive by Southeast Asian standards. Budget rooms: S$60–100/night. Mid-range: S$150–300/night. Luxury: S$500+/night. However, quality is consistently high and service is exceptional.

Is Marina Bay Sands worth it?

The infinity pool and views are genuinely spectacular. Rooms start from around S$550–700/night. If budget allows, staying at MBS is one of travel's great experiences. Day access to the rooftop is available for non-guests who dine there.

Should I stay on Sentosa in Singapore?

Only if you're spending significant time at Universal Studios, the beaches, or family attractions. Otherwise, staying in the main city and day-tripping to Sentosa is more flexible and often cheaper.
